WebMay 13, 2024 · Growing phormiums from seed is not for the novice – it poses something of a challenge. However, if you would like to give it a try, you can collect ripe seed and sow it in a propagator, at 18°C in spring. Be warned, however, the seed may grow into a plant that differs considerably from the parent plant. WebDescription. New Zealand flax can be planted in almost any soil type. WebPhormiums are most easily propagated by division in the spring. Simply dig around the plant and gently prise away some of the side shoots from the main clump. The side shoots will have developed their own root systems and care should be taken to ensure that the offsets do have some roots with them. If these are small and inadequate pot them on ...
